4 Healthy Reasons to Add Beets to Your Diet

  1. Rich in Nutrients and Antioxidants
    Beets are loaded with essential vitamins and minerals like folate, vitamin C, potassium, and iron. They also contain betalains, powerful antioxidants that give beets their vibrant red color and help reduce inflammation in the body.
  2. Supports Heart Health
    Beets are high in nitrates, which convert to nitric oxide in the body, helping to relax and widen blood vessels. This process can lower blood pressure and improve overall cardiovascular health.
  3. Boosts Stamina and Athletic Performance
    The same nitrates that support heart health can also enhance athletic performance. By increasing oxygen flow, beets improve endurance, making workouts more efficient.
  4. Aids in Digestion and Detoxification
    Beets are a good source of dietary fiber, supporting a healthy digestive system and promoting regular bowel movements. They also support liver health by encouraging the body’s natural detoxification process.

Healthy and Tasty Beet Recipe: Roasted Beet and Citrus Salad

Ingredients

Instructions

  1. Roast the Beets: Preheat the oven to 400°F (204°C). Place the beet cubes on a baking sheet lined with parchment paper. Drizzle with olive oil, salt, and pepper. Roast for 25-30 minutes, flipping halfway through, until tender. Let cool.
  2. Prepare the Dressing: In a small bowl, whisk together the olive oil, balsamic vinegar, lemon juice, salt, and pepper.
  3. Assemble the Salad: In a large bowl, add the mixed greens. Top with roasted beets, orange segments, red onion slices, and goat cheese (if using).
  4. Add the Finishing Touches: Drizzle the dressing over the salad. Sprinkle with fresh mint leaves and toasted walnuts.
  5. Serve and Enjoy: Toss gently to combine and serve immediately.

This salad is a perfect balance of sweet, savory, and tangy flavors. It’s great as a main dish or as a refreshing side.
